Output 86456f0636447c10e34cbb68e63a8c59b819eb15302a285f5ce3dadcf341222f:1

value
18843580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6dbce8f07f9209401937e8056573317410e03ddc OP_EQUALVERIFY OP_CHECKSIG
address
1B1ExbrFK3TmYKD8rDg2KC1Dv4FX9ZFP8M
transaction
86456f0636447c10e34cbb68e63a8c59b819eb15302a285f5ce3dadcf341222f
spent
true